Lidar Mapping Robot Vacuum

A lidar vacuum mop mapping robot vacuum utilizes lasers to draw an internal map of your home. It is more precise than gyroscope-based systems and allows you set off-limits areas to mop.

The vacuum cleaner can clean more efficiently and safely making a map. This technology decreases the risk of collisions and saves energy.

Accuracy

Lidar is used by many robot vacuum cleaners to enhance navigation. It operates by sending an optical beam and measuring the time it takes the light to reflect off objects before returning to the sensor. This information is used to calculate the distance between an object. It is a more precise way to measure the position of a robot than traditional GPS that requires an unobstructed view of the surrounding. It is particularly suited for large rooms with complex furniture or layouts.

Lidar is not just able to map, but also determine objects' shape and location. This is crucial for robots to avoid collisions. It is important to know that lidar vacuum robot does have some limitations. One of them is that it may fail to recognize reflective or transparent surfaces, such as glass coffee tables. The resulting error can cause the robot to move through the table, and could end up damaging it. Manufacturers can overcome this issue by increasing the sensitivities of lidar sensors, or by combining them with bumper sensors and cameras to enhance navigation and mapping.

Cost

Many robot vacuums are based on a variety of sensors to navigate your home and clean all corners. They also can tell you the state of their batteries and when it's time to recharge. The best robotic vacuums have advanced mapping technology that gives a more accurate and efficient cleaning. These devices use laser and optical sensors to map a room's layout and plan its route in a planned way. They are more effective than traditional navigational systems.

The most advanced mapping robots employ LiDAR, also known as Light Detection and Ranging technology. This technology was initially designed for the aerospace industry. It emits beams of light within the infrared spectrum and determines the time required to reach an object. The data is used to create a digital 3D map of the surrounding environment. This map assists the robot avoid obstacles and navigate through the house without getting lost. Some models even show their digital maps in the app so that you can see where they have been.

Another kind of mapping system is gyroscope-based, which calculates distance and direction using accelerometer sensors. These devices aren't as precise as lidar robot vacuum sensors, but are still useful for basic navigation.
